Donald Trump defeated Nikki Haley in her home state of South Carolina, a stinging setback that narrows her vanishingly thin path to the nomination. Most of the GOP are now waiting to see if Haley will drop out if the race. Trump won by a large margin getting 60% of the votes leaving Haley behind d with 40%.

Palmetto state voters have a long history of choosing the party’s eventual nominee, and Trump is on track to clinch the Republican nomination months before the party’s summer convention in Milwaukee. Haley served as an Ambassador to the UN under Trump as president.
